Tar and gravel roof services involve the installation, repair, and maintenance of roofs that use a combination of bitumen (tar) and loose gravel to create a durable, weather-resistant surface. This type of roofing system is known for its affordability and proven performance over many years. Service providers can handle tasks such as applying new layers of gravel, sealing leaks, replacing damaged sections, and ensuring the overall integrity of the roof. Proper maintenance and timely repairs can help extend the lifespan of a tar and gravel roof, preventing more costly issues down the line.

Many common problems can be addressed through tar and gravel roof services. Over time, gravel may shift or become dislodged, exposing the underlying layers to damage from the elements. Cracks, blisters, or punctures can develop, leading to leaks that threaten the interior of a property. Additionally, the asphalt or bitumen layers can degrade due to age and weather exposure, resulting in reduced waterproofing. Service providers can identify these issues early and perform necessary repairs to prevent water intrusion, structural damage, and mold growth.

This roofing style is often found on commercial buildings, industrial facilities, and some residential properties, especially those with flat or low-slope roofs. Due to its cost-effectiveness and ease of installation, tar and gravel roofs are popular in areas with heavy rainfall or snow, such as North Bergen, NJ. The overview below groups typical Tar And Gravel Roof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in North Bergen, NJ.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or repairs, such as replacing loose gravel or patching small leaks,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age and accessibility.

Partial Restoration - For sections of a tar and gravel roof needing repairs or localized replacement, costs usually range from $1,000-$3,500. Larger, more complex projects can reach higher, but most projects stay within this band.

Full Roof Replacement - Complete replacement of a tar and gravel roof in North Bergen often costs between $5,000 and $12,000. Larger or more intricate roofs can exceed this range, but many projects are completed within the lower to mid-tier budgets.

Major Overhauls - Extensive renovations or complete overhauls of large commercial roofs can surpass $15,000, with some highly complex jobs reaching $20,000 or more. These projects are less common and typically involve significant structural considerations.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What services do contractors offer for tar and gravel roofs? Local contractors can perform roof inspections, repairs, maintenance, and full replacements of tar and gravel roofing systems to ensure durability and proper functionality.

How can I tell if my tar and gravel roof needs repairs? Signs such as pooling water, cracks, loose gravel, or visible damage indicate that a roof may need professional repair or maintenance from local service providers.

Are tar and gravel roof services suitable for historic buildings? Yes, experienced contractors can assess and perform necessary repairs or restorations to preserve the integrity of historic structures with tar and gravel roofs.

What maintenance tasks are recommended for tar and gravel roofs? Regular inspections, debris removal, patching of small cracks, and gravel leveling are common maintenance services provided by local roof specialists.

Can local contractors handle roof replacements for tar and gravel systems? Yes, many service providers are equipped to remove old tar and gravel roofs and install new roofing systems tailored to the building's needs.
